Micro-Deval Test Apparatus
Laboratory Type Testing Device for Determinating the Resistance of Aggregates to Wear
The Micro-Deval Test Apparatus is designed to determine the resistance to wear of 25–50 mm sized aggregates. This test is conducted in accordance with international standards to evaluate the durability of materials used in applications such as road construction and railway ballast. The device can operate with 4 drums of Ø200 x 154 mm or 2 drums of Ø200 x 400 mm. Drum rotation speed is 100 ± 5 rpm. Device is equipped with a user-adjustable digital automatic revolution counter, and the device stops automatically at the end of the test.
Drums and steel balls must be ordered separately.
